Description

Motomco Prowler Pelleted BaitProwler rodenticides, exclusively from Motomco, are formulated to control even the toughest infestations on farms and agricultural operations. Prowler baits fuse the proven, acute active Bromethalin with proprietary ingredients to create formulas designed to maximize palatability and bait acceptance. Using Motomco's newest method for active ingredient synthesis, Prowler uses Bromethalin to achieve results with less bait compared to anticoagulants.

Prowler Pelleted Bait provides additional flexibility and are labeled for use in rat burrows beyond 100 ft of buildings.

  • Palatable formulas with ingredients designed to appeal to the widest possible rodent population
  • Made with Bromethalin, an acute active ingredient to achieve results with less bait vs anticoagulants
  • Utilizes our newest method of synthesizing Bromethalin active, developed by Motomco scientists for consistency & purity
  • Due to Stop Feed Action, rats and mice typically feed less or cease feeding altogether after consuming a lethal dose
  • Excellent choice for burrow baiting - labeled for rat burrows beyond 100 ft of buildings
  • Can be used indoors in areas inaccessible to children, pets or non-target animals
